This my final capture of 47 Tuc globular cluster before it disappears down towards the horizon and returns later this year in the Spring
Captured in Sydney under Bortle 8 skies
Seeing average and a bit of dew around
6” f6 Bintel GSO newt
EQ6-R Mount
Canon 600D stock DSLR with home made cooling fan
No filters used
Orion 60mm guide scope with ZWOASI120MM-S guide camera
ISO 800
60 x 60 sec dithered guided subs
20 x darks
PHD2 guiding ( 0.90 to 1.00 arc sec error )
BYEOS frame , focus and capture
EQMOD , StellariumScope and Stellarium for navigation, Goto and tracking
Stacked in DSS
Processed in Startools V1.5
